When you are looking at garage door costs, keep in mind that the final bill depends on a few moving parts. The material you choose—like steel, wood, or aluminum—plays a big role, as does the level of insulation required for your home. You also have to factor in the size of the door, the complexity of the hardware, and whether you are replacing the tracks and springs at the same time.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
If your garage door opener is failing to respond, is outdated, or lacks modern safety features, we provide full installation services. We mount the new motor unit, connect it to your existing door, and program your remotes and wall consoles. We can also help you switch to a quieter belt-drive system or a model with smart home connectivity. If your opener is struggling to lift the door, a new installation is often the best solution.
